Transaction

59a736c0c62d6050a442badfc52f53cc67dad7393e3889263ea99077fcde70db

Summary

In Block161170
TimeSat, 29 Apr 2023 00:51:30 UTC
Total Input2446.54689368 Nebula
Total Output2501.54689368 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
731326 Confirmations2501.54689368 Nebula
Raw Transaction